What’s up Austin - Weekend Line-up

by

Guitar Art: If you’ve been downtown you’ve probably noticed some rather large guitars. In fact, there are now 35 of them located around Austin. The 10-foot tall guitars were presented by Gibson Guitars and will be auctioned off at some point. Enjoy them while you can.

Austin Farmers’ Market: If you haven’t had fresh fruit or veggies lately you should hit the Farmers Market. Until a friend gave me some home grown tomatoes recently, I’d forgotten how much more flavourful home grown tastes. Saturdays, 9am-4pm at 5th and Guadalupe.

Austin’s Artists Market: Saturdays, 10am-6pm next to Mother Egan’s Pub on 6th Street. Features paintings, jewelry, stained glass, candles and morel.

Tube San Marcos: Tube rentals are open 10am-7pm. Get there before 5:30pm if you want to rent. Tubing in San Marcos is a summer tradition!

Welcome Back Kotter: Gabe Kaplan makes an appearance at BookPeople. July 7th, 7pm.

Faraday’s Foodie-Palooza: Faraday’s celebrates their second anniversary with cooking and product demos, door prizes and sales. Friday and Saturday from 10am-6pm

Independence Brewery: You’re invited to share some love for Barton Springs as the Independence Brewing Company hosts their 2nd annual Freestyle for Barton Springs Jump Contest. The winning jump will be featured on a special edition label Independence Freestyle Wheat Beer and the $25 entry fee will benefit the Austin Parks Foundation. Contest starts at 8:30am, after party starts at noon. Also this weekend is their regular 1st Saturday brewery tour and free beer sampling. What’s not to love about free beer?

Specifically for the kids:

Paint yer Wagon: Or in this case, your train! Terra Toys, Sunday July 8th, 1-3pm, kids can paint their own boxcars or tankers, supplies provided! Free!

Thanks for the Memories: Saturday, July 7th, 9am-noon, ages 5-12, all Home Depot Locations. Kids can make memory boxes to hold their treasures. All tools and materials provided. Free!

What’s all the Hoop-la? Why it’s World Hoop Day! Join musician Laura Scharborough for a da of hula=hooping instruction with special large, weioghted hoops. Sat., July 7th, 11am-1:30-pm at the Austin Children’s Museum at the Dell Discover Center.
